From af4878266cf0876b22adec3c9d1792fc042027c2 Mon Sep 17 00:00:00 2001 From: Yury Sannikov Date: Thu, 14 Dec 2023 02:47:59 +0300 Subject: [PATCH] split steps --- .github/workflows/build-module.yml | 17 ++++++++++++----- 1 file changed, 12 insertions(+), 5 deletions(-) diff --git a/.github/workflows/build-module.yml b/.github/workflows/build-module.yml index ae6f6c9..1a368c9 100644 --- a/.github/workflows/build-module.yml +++ b/.github/workflows/build-module.yml @@ -63,7 +63,7 @@ jobs: echo " > make target/linux/compile" make target/linux/compile V=s - - name: Building AmneziaWG + - name: Update feeds run: | echo "CONFIG_PACKAGE_amnezia-wg-tools=y" >> .config echo "CONFIG_PACKAGE_luci-app-amneziawg=y" >> .config @@ -81,14 +81,21 @@ jobs: ./scripts/feeds update awgopenwrt ./scripts/feeds install -a -p awgopenwrt + - name: Build amnezia-wg-tools + run: | make package/amnezia-wg-tools/{clean,download,prepare} - make package/luci-app-amneziawg/{clean,download,prepare} - make package/kmod-amneziawg/{clean,download,prepare} - make package/amnezia-wg-tools/compile - make package/luci-app-amneziawg/compile V=s + + - name: Build kmod-amneziawg + run: | + make package/kmod-amneziawg/{clean,download,prepare} make package/kmod-amneziawg/compile + - name: Build luci + run: | + make package/luci-app-amneziawg/{clean,download,prepare} + make package/luci-app-amneziawg/compile V=s + - name: LS Packages run: | ls -al bin/packages/${{ matrix.build_env.pkgarch }}/awgopenwrt